Megosztás a következőn keresztül:


CURRENT_TIMEZONE_ID (Transact-SQL)

A következőkre vonatkozik: Az SQL Server 2022 (16.x) és újabb verziói az Azure SQL DatabaseAzure SQL Managed InstanceSQL-adatbázist a Microsoft Fabricben

Ez a függvény visszaadja az időzóna azonosítóját, amelyet egy szerver vagy egy példány figyel. Az Azure SQL Managed Instance esetében a return érték az instance létrehozása során kijelölt időzónán alapul, nem az operációs rendszer időzónáján.

Megjegyzés:

SQL adatbázis esetén az időzóna mindig UTC-re van állítva, és CURRENT_TIMEZONE_ID az UTC időzóna azonosítóját adja vissza.

Szemantika

CURRENT_TIMEZONE_ID ( )  

Arguments

Ez a függvény nem vesz fel argumentumokat.

Visszatérési típus

varchar

Megjegyzések

CURRENT_TIMEZONE_ID egy nem-determinisztikus függvény. Az oszlopra hivatkozó nézetek és kifejezések nem indexelhetők.

Example

A visszaadott érték tükrözi a szerver vagy az instance tényleges időzónájának és nyelvi beállításait.

SELECT CURRENT_TIMEZONE_ID();  
/* Returned:  
W. Europe Standard Time
*/

Lásd még

SQL Managed Instance Time Zone

CURRENT_TIMEZONE()